●
Before towing, please ensure that the
car to be towed has a good lighting system.
●
During towing, please abide by the
legal provisions for maximum speed.
●
Don’t exceed 100km/h.
●
No sudden starting, speeding up or
stopping.
●
No sharp turning or sudden changing
lanes.
●
Drive at a medium speed.
●
Abide by instructions of Towing
Manual.
●
Choose proper coupling devices
(including tow hook, safety chain and
others). You may consult Chongqing
Jinkang dealer for purchasing such devices
and more notes for towing.
●
The towing load (total of trailer and
cargo) shall not be more than the setting
value of vehicle and coupling device. For
further details, please consult Chongqing
Jinkang dealer.
●
As for trailer loading, put the heavier
objects above the car. The load shall not
exceed the maximum vertical load of tow
hook.
●
Please regularly maintain your car.
The interval for maintenance shall not be
less than the specified value on the
Maintenance Manual.
●
Due to the increase of traction and
resistance, the towing may consume much
electricity than that consumed by normal
driving.
●
In
towing,
please
note
the
temperature indicator of motor coolant, to
avoid overheating vehicle.
Tire Pressure
When towing, inflate tires to meet the
maximum
recommended
value
(or
full-load) marked on the winter wheels.
Don't tow your car with spare tires.
Safety Chain
Use the qualified safety chain between
your car and trailer. Cross the safety chain
and fix it onto the tow hook rather than the
bumper or axle. Ensure that there is
enough space for steering.
